Is bond applicable even for self financing govt quota seats in Tamil Nadu...frnds plls help

Dear Subha, usually all the students taking admission in Government medical colleges are required to sign a bond of service failing which theyare required to pay the bond amount to the respective State. Self financing Medical and Dental colleges are also bound by this bond. So to just answer your question, even if it is a self financing private medical college and if you get a Medical seat in Govt.qupta, you have to abide by the bond.
